Hi all! I am using happily Xcode (Version 3.2.1) to develop my projects, and now I am facing a, maybe, weird problem to solve.
I am using a library (the Qt, BTW) that creates some intermediate *source* code files, that I'd like to add automatically to my project. Is there a way to create a script, called in a "Run script" phase, that calls the source generation program, and next adds the results to a group?
Just another question. Why has Xcode an arrow on a "Run Script" phase, although there is no way of "adding" any script to it? I mean, I can call scripts in the "script" area that appears double-clicking on the phase, but I cannot drag and drop any script there... or so it seems to me!
